RICHARD HOBDAY, PhD., born in England, received his Ph.D. Degree
from the School of Engineering, Cranfield University, England. As a
Chartered Engineer, Richard has been responsible for a number of projects
concerned with solar energy, energy efficiency and health in buildings.
Working alongside Architects on one particular project he became aware
of a lost tradition of designing sunlit buildings to prevent
disease, rather than to save energy, and became interested in the healing
powers of sunlight. He began to study the history of Sunlight Therapy
and found that the Physicians who practiced this ancient healing art
called Heliotherapy, and the Architects who supported them in their
work, used sunlight very differently from the way many of us do today.
Dr. Hobday has become a leading authority on the history and practice
of Sunlight Therapy. He is the author of The Healing Sun: Sunlight
and Health in the 21st Century, a very revealing book on the beneficial
effects of sunlight on human health. He relates how sunlight can help
prevent and heal many common diseases like breast, prostate and colon
cancer, heart disease, multiple sclerosis and osteoporosis. He also
describes how sunlight speeds up the healing of wounds and relieves
stress. The book also has information on how to sunbathe safely and
the importance of full spectrum light.
